Some of my favorite Breckenridge moments:
One year, there were eight B-25s on hand (at that time, it was the largest gathering of Mitchells since the filming of
Catch 22).
Another year, there were 16 P-51s on hand, and they flew a simulated fighter sweep over the airfield (still the largest number of 'Stangs that I've ever seen in person).
Another time, the USAF BONE'd us!

(B-1B flying demonstration)
The warbird turnout was considered to be disappointing if there were less than 150 warbirds on hand. Typically, it was more like TWO HUNDRED.
Yep, there were five Corsairs on the ramp in Pat's film.
There will never be another gathering like "Beercanridge".
